Summit/Ascent: No EMG Sound from Base Speakers

Sierra Summit/Ascent EMG audio is normally heard from the base unit speakers.  When EMG audio is not heard from the base unit speakers, there are a few corrective actions to take.

First, verify that the audio mute checkbox at the top of the EMG recording screen is not checked.  Pressing the Volume Knob will also un-mute the audio.
Next, check the Sierra Summit/Ascent software version in the help/about menu.  If it is Sierra software is version 1.0 then update to a higher version.  For Sierra/Ascent versions 1.1 and higher, follow these steps:

Summit Settings:

  1. Launch the Sierra Summit/Ascent
  2. Click on Edit, then System Setup
  3. Click on the Audio Setup button
  4. Set the EMG Audio Device (Live and Playback) to “Summit Speakers (USB Audio CODEC)”
  5. Click the OK button to close the Audio Setup window
  6. Click OK again to close the System Setup window
  7. Close the Sierra Summit/Ascent program
  8. Open Summit/Ascent to see if EMG audio is working properly

Windows Audio Settings:

  1. Click on the Windows speaker icon located in the taskbar next to the Windows time
  2. Click on Mixer
  3. Click on the speaker selection pull down arrow then Select “Summit Speakers (USB AudioCodec)”
  4. Verify that the speaker is not muted as indicated by a red symbol over the speaker.  Click on the speaker symbol to un-mute it
  5. Turn volume adjustment to a higher position if it is set to zero or very low
  6. Open Summit/Ascent to see if EMG audio is working properly

Summit/Ascent Speaker Driver Verification:

  1. Close Sierra Summit/Ascent program
  2. Click Windows Start (Windows 7)
  3. Enter/type in Device Manager in the search box (Windows 7 and 10)
  4. Click on Device Manager from listed results
  5. Expand Sound, Video and Game Controller list
  6. Look for USB Audio Codec and note if an exclamation error symbol appears
  7. If error symbol is present, right click on USB Audio Codec
  8. Select Update Driver Software
  9. Select Let me pick from a list of devices on my computer
  10. Select USB Audio Device
  11. Click on Next
  12. Close
  13. Recheck status –   error symbol should be gone
  14. Close Device Manager window
  15. Open Summit/Ascent to see if EMG audio is working properly
